Autun. the Servo Institution Closes After Fifty Years of Activity: "It's Not a Store, It's Our Life"

Summary by lejsl.com
Over the years, the entire appearance of the Marchaux district has evolved except perhaps two things: the tower and... the Sermo store. Two institutions. With their windows overflowing with working clothes, lingerie, chapelwork and above all the kindness of the bosses, Marina and José Pinto have marked generations of Austrians. For the 50 years of existence, the couple resolved to close shop at the end of February.
